Re: How to migrate from Papers3 to Bookends
I have been working with Jon offline (great support, Jon) and here is a summary of what we have found. The online instructions for this migration (export Papers3 repository as XML, import into Bookends, move Papers3 files into Bookends folders) will only give you the unannoted pdfs from Papers3.
